From CAD to Completion: The CNC Wall Panel Process
The journey of a CNC wall panel begins with its conception in Computer-Aided Design software.{ Once the design is finalized, it's meticulously transferred to the CNC machine. This sophisticated machine utilizes a rotating cutting tool guided by a precise program to carve the design from raw material. The choice of material varies depending on the desired outcome, with options such as wood, plastic, or even metal being common choices. Throughout the process, multiple layers may be used to create complex designs and textures, adding depth and visual appeal to the final product.
Quality control is paramount at every stage. Skilled technicians carefully inspect each panel for accuracy and adherence to the original design. After completion, the panels are prepped for installation, which can range from simple wall cladding to intricate decorative elements.
